The postcode N1 0AE is located in Islington, in the county of Inner London. It was introduced in December 2000 and is an active postcode. N1 0AE is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

N1 0AE is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of N1 0AE as Ethnicity central > Aspirational techies > Old EU tech workers.

The closest road name to N1 0AE is A5200 which is centered 38 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Randell's Road and is 24 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 625 m away at King's Cross St.Pancras Underground Station The closest railway station is London King's Cross Rail Station, 618 m away.

The closest primary school to N1 0AE (for ages 11 and under) is Kings Cross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on May 10,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Regent High School. The last OFSTED inspection on January 31, 2018 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of N1 0AE is Hurrican Room and is 771 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Satisfactory on June 4,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Creams and is 801 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on March 15,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 115.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 18.1 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 0.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for N1 0AE is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Islington is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
